Edward Nelson
Edward Nelson, 97, died at his home in Spring Grove, on March 23, 2005, after a short bout with bladder cancer.
He was born on August 9, 1907 in Sturgis, SD to Nels and Martha (Berquam) Nelson.
His mother died when he was 8 and he came to live with Berquam relatives in Spring Grove. Later, he moved with them to Badger, MN and then Mankato.
On January 9, 1934, he married Melia Havig, of Spring Grove, at Roseau, MN.
After retirement, they lived in Spring Grove and Caledonia.
ln 1968, he was Sons of Norway lodge president of the year.
In 1960, he was appointed by the Speaker of the House to be Sargeant of Arms at tbe Minnesota Legislature for the 60-62 legislative session.
He is survived by his daughter, Nancy; one sister, Beulah Wanhanen, Nemo, SD; and a brother, John of Spearfish, SD.
He was preceded in death by his wife, Melia in 2000, his parents, and nine siblings
